[問題] 急!!!高手指點迷津 c跳入flex 變數問題

看板Flash作者 (生日時越來越沒感覺)時間15年前 (2010/06/10 01:29), 編輯推噓1(103)
留言4則, 3人參與, 最新討論串1/1
大家好: 目前瘋狂的想寫完一個圍棋client,碰上一堆問題,懇請各位大師解惑。 最大的問題且急需的有兩個~ 1.flex中如何寫出跟c/c++的xxx.h一樣 比如xxx.h中的變數string 給a.cpp和b.cpp及c.cpp.....一起共用變數string的寫法 2.flex中的mxml和mxml間如何傳遞值 比如a.mxml要傳一個字串str到b.mxml中~需要如何寫? example片段: A.mxml ========================================================================= <?xml version="1.0" encoding="utf-8"?> <mx:DataGrid xmlns:mx="http://www.adobe.com/2006/mxml" rowCount="10" editable="false" valueCommit="OnSelect(event)"> <mx:Script> public function OnSelect(event:Event):void { if( this.selectedItem ) this.selectedItem.invite = 1; } </mx:Script> <mx:columns> <mx:DataGridColumn width="100" dataField="name" headerText="玩家"/> <mx:DataGridColumn width="80" dataField="invite" headerText="" itemRenderer="ButtonRenderer"/> <mx:DataGridColumn width="80" dataField="測試區" headerText="{this.selectedItem.name}" /> </mx:columns> ButtonRenderer.mxml ========================================================================= 要取得A.mxml中滑鼠選取該列的名稱(this.selectedItem.name) 兩個問題都是想解決同一件事情~~ 請大家幫忙~感謝 -- 活在只有0與1的世界中.... 一切的不確定性都能造成當機 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.224.42.2 ※ 編輯: boriscus 來自: 61.224.42.2 (06/10 01:32)

06/10 02:23, , 1F
我想從c/c++過來的朋友應該第一個就是不習慣OOP的寫法
06/10 02:23, 1F

06/10 07:30, , 2F
2. outerDocument.
06/10 07:30, 2F

06/13 00:54, , 3F
public static var your_variable_name:your_class_name
06/13 00:54, 3F

06/13 00:55, , 4F
最後用your_class_name.your_variable_name就可以取得了
06/13 00:55, 4F
文章代碼(AID): #1C3yzhMx (Flash)